Output 51123f817196dac2dd7833efef8dc59b1383976df5d9c2a67f9bc0425abec1be:1

value
3566288
script pubkey
OP_0 OP_PUSHBYTES_20 04e89bdc0c3f137774eb016d3448d2e0fb3e06d2
address
ltc1qqn5fhhqv8ufhwa8tq9kngjxjuranupkjglxkvx
transaction
51123f817196dac2dd7833efef8dc59b1383976df5d9c2a67f9bc0425abec1be
spent
true